McDuffie Holds Roundtable on Public Financing of Elections

***MEDIA ALERT***

What:

Councilmember Kenyan R. McDuffie (D – Ward 5), Chairperson of the Committee on Government Operations, will convene a public roundtable on the feasibility of converting to a public financing model for elections in District of Columbia.

Various jurisdictions around the country have enacted legislation converting their campaign financing systems to public or quasi-public financing models.  The roundtable will also provide an opportunity for the committee to hear from witnesses on best practices from their jurisdictions and get a better understanding about financing publicly-funded elections.
